Assessing Your Yard and Preparation the Format
When you prepare to set up a lawn sprinkler system, the initial step is reviewing your backyard and intending the format. Begin by observing the size and shape of your backyard. Recognize locations that need watering, such as flower beds, grass, and veggie yards. Make note of sunlight exposure and any shaded places, as these aspects influence water requirements.
Next, think about the water pressure offered to you. Test it using a straightforward stress scale to confirm your system can function successfully. Strategy the placement of sprinkler heads based upon coverage; you'll desire them to overlap slightly to stay clear of dry spots.
Sketch a harsh format, marking the areas of the main lines and lawn sprinkler heads. Think of the sorts of lawn sprinklers you'll use and their reach. Preparation thoroughly currently will make your setup easier and confirm your plants obtain the best quantity of water.

Identifying Trench Deepness
Establishing the right trench depth is vital for guaranteeing your sprinkler system functions efficiently. Normally, you'll wish to dig trenches concerning 6 to 12 inches deep, relying on your local climate and the sort of pipelines you're making use of. Much deeper trenches aid prevent pipes from cold if you live in a location with freezing temperature levels. Make sure to take into consideration the dimension of your pipelines; larger pipes might call for much deeper trenches for correct installment. Furthermore, inspect neighborhood codes or laws, as they might determine specific depth needs. As you dig, maintain the trench size workable-- around 12 inches is normally adequate. In this manner, you can quickly set up and access the pipes when required, guaranteeing your system runs smoothly.

Mounting Lawn Sprinkler Heads and Valves
Setting up sprinkler heads and valves is an essential action in creating a get more info reliable watering system for your yard or garden (Sprinkler installation). Begin by placing the sprinkler heads at the marked places, making sure they're uniformly spaced for perfect coverage. Dig a little opening for every head, confirming it's deep sufficient for appropriate installation
Following, connect the sprinkler heads to the pipelines, protecting them tightly to protect against leaks. Use Teflon tape on the strings for added guarantee.
When it involves valves, select an area easily accessible for maintenance. Install the shutoffs according to the supplier's guidelines, connecting them to the mainline pipes. Make sure they're degree and safe, as this will assist with consistent water circulation.
Lastly, examination each sprinkler head and shutoff for proper feature before hiding any kind of pipelines. This step warranties your system operates efficiently and efficiently, giving the best look after your plants.
Connecting the Key Supply Of Water
With the lawn sprinkler heads and valves safely in position, you'll now attach the main water system to your irrigation system. Begin by situating the main water line, normally near your home's foundation. Shut down the water to avoid any kind of leaks or spills during the procedure. Next, utilize a pipeline cutter to produce a clean cut in the primary line, making specific it's the right dimension for your fittings. Set up a T-fitting to draw away water into your automatic sprinkler. Make certain it's securely secured, and use Teflon tape on the strings for a water tight seal. After that, attach the PVC pipe causing your lawn sprinkler system to the T-fitting. Validate all links are tight and leak-free. Once everything's in location, turn the water system back on gradually, checking for any leaks at the joints. This step is crucial for a smooth procedure of your automatic sprinkler.
Testing the System and Adjustments
After you've connected the main supply of water, it's time to evaluate your lawn sprinkler. Turn on the water and observe how each area runs. Stroll around your lawn to inspect for even insurance coverage, guaranteeing no locations are completely dry or as well damp. If you see any type of completely dry places, it may indicate a sprinkler head is blocked or misaligned. Adjust the heads as necessary to route water where it's needed most.
Lastly, make note of the watering period required for each and every area and readjust your timer setups to enhance water use. Routine testing and modifications will help keep a reliable system that maintains your landscape flourishing.
Frequently Asked Questions
How much time Does It Commonly Require To Install a Lawn Sprinkler?
Usually, setting up an automatic sprinkler takes anywhere from one to 3 days, depending upon your lawn's dimension and intricacy. If you're doing it on your own or working with aid., you'll desire to prepare for additional time.
Can I Set Up a Sprinkler System During Winter?
You can install a lawn sprinkler throughout winter, but it's challenging. Cold temperatures can freeze pipelines, making installation tough. If you pick to proceed, see to it you're prepared for possible difficulties and secure your devices effectively.
What Is the Ordinary Cost of a New Lawn Sprinkler System?
The average expense of a brand-new lawn sprinkler system commonly varies in between $2,000 and $4,000, depending upon your backyard dimension and system intricacy. You'll want to obtain numerous quotes to discover the most effective option for you.
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Sprinkler Equipments?
Yes, there are eco-friendly choices for lawn sprinkler. You can select drip watering, rain sensing get more info units, or wise controllers that optimize water use and reduce waste, aiding you maintain a lavish garden while being eco conscious.
Just how Typically Should I Maintain My Lawn Sprinkler?
When in springtime and once in loss,You ought to keep your sprinkler system at least two times a year--. Regular checks assist assure efficiency, protect against leaks, and maintain your lawn healthy, conserving you time and money in the long run.
